Bespoke metal staircases

From design to production, every staircase is a unique work. Metalbril designs and produces bespoke metal staircases for interior designers, architects and general contractors.

We specialise in the design and production of made to measure staircases. A unique process that transforms an idea into a work.

Designing and producing a made to measure metal staircase requires expertise that spans multiple disciplines: structural engineering, artisanal metalworking, knowledge of surface finishes and the ability to manage on-site installation with the same precision applied throughout production. At Metalbril, all of this happens in-house, through an integrated process that starts from 3D modelling and concludes with the installed and AID-certified staircase.

Helical staircases, spiral staircases, suspended staircases and modern interior staircases in brass, iron, stainless steel, aluminium and copper: every type is designed and produced to measure, with premium metal finishes developed on sample and validated before production. Every project is born from a direct exchange with the designer, for private residences, luxury hotels and high-end contract spaces.

What we do

Project analysis

We listen to the brief, study the space and define with the designer the materials, typology and technical feasibility.

Design

3D modelling, high-resolution rendering and executive drawings to validate every detail before production.

Production

Laser cutting, bending, TIG welding and in-house carpentry with AID-certified quality control on every structural element.

Finishes

Artisanal bespoke sampling: oxidized, burnished, painted or materic, validated under real lighting conditions before production.

Certifications

CE Marking — EN 1090

Metalbril holds CE Marking in accordance with European standard EN 1090 for the execution of steel and aluminium structures and components. Every metal carpentry element we produce complies with the safety and performance requirements of the European market.

AID Certification — Accredia-accredited body

Our factory production control system (FPC) is certified by AID, an Accredia-accredited body and the only national organisation authorised by the Italian State to issue accreditations. Metalbril’s production processes, from welding to finishing, are monitored and compliant with European quality standards.

Types of staircases we produce

Bespoke open-riser metal staircase made by Metalbril in a contemporary interior design space

Open staircases

Open structure without risers, with cantilevered treads or side stringer. Maximum visual lightness and spatial continuity, in iron, stainless steel or brass with custom finishes.

Bespoke cantilevered floating staircase with suspended steps and glass railing by Metalbril

Cantilevered staircases

Treads anchored directly to the wall with no visible structure. The result is a staircase of great visual impact, with a sculptural lightness that only precisely worked metal can guarantee.

Bespoke outdoor spiral metal staircase with white finish made by Metalbril

Outdoor staircases

Designed to withstand weathering, in stainless steel or iron with specific protective treatments. The same artisanal care and attention to detail as our interior staircases.

Bespoke helical metal staircase with burnished brass finish made by Metalbril

Helical staircases

The most scenic typology. The structure wraps around itself with a formal continuity that transforms the staircase into an autonomous architectural element, capable of defining the identity of the entire space.
